## Read-Replica Lag Alarm

New folks: the ReplicaLagHigh alarm covers the Ostrel reporting replicas. It fires when lag exceeds 90 seconds for five minutes. Most triggers come from the nightly Bramwell export job, which is expected and auto-resolves. Do not fail over the replica yourself — that requires the data-platform lead's approval and a change ticket. If the alarm persists past 20 minutes with no export running, write to the platform inbox.

billing contact of yahip-yadup = eliax.druix@zemvarworks.corp

Action item: Digest scheduler in Mailharrow double-sent weekly batches when a DST shift landed inside the scheduling window. Fix pins schedule evaluation to UTC and adds an idempotency key per batch. Reviewer: confirm the key derivation covers retries. Design notes and the test matrix are on the internal page below.

dashboard of yafog-fajof = https://jira.tolvaqsys.internal/pages/pages/projects/49fe21c4

**Q: The LiftLogic simulator keeps rejecting my dispatch config — who do I ask?**

A: Config schemas changed in release 4.2, so older sample files from the Harwick repo won't validate. Pull the current templates from the simulator's docs folder first. If validation still fails, the Dispatch Tools team handles contractor questions and can review your file.

escalation mailbox, yajeg-bageg: quenax.olidor@lumiccorp.internal

Migration step 4 — Stalecache remediation (Pricebin service)

Per the postmortem, the stale-cache bug came from the old invalidation fanout dropping events under load. This step swaps Pricebin to versioned cache keys. Reviewer: confirm the TTLs match the postmortem's recommendations, verify the fanout consumer is fully removed, and check that warmup runs before traffic shift. No data migration needed; old keys expire naturally. Apply the new settings exactly as shown below.

settings of taguf-fajef:
[eliath]
team = julir
access_code = ac_78465c
host = eliath.lumicgrid.local
port = 8443
owner = feniel.wenir
peer = quenmir.tolvaqsys.local